Through-hole mount isolated DC converters are electronic devices designed to convert direct current (DC) voltage from one level to another while providing electrical isolation between input and output circuits. These converters are characterized by their through-hole mounting technology, which involves leads inserted into drilled holes on a printed circuit board (PCB) and soldered in place, ensuring mechanical stability and durability in demanding environments. They typically feature galvanic isolation, which prevents ground loops, reduces noise, and enhances safety by separating input and output grounds. Common applications include industrial automation, telecommunications, medical equipment, and power supplies where reliable voltage conversion and isolation are critical. Key specifications include input/output voltage ranges, power ratings, efficiency, isolation voltage, and operating temperature, with variations tailored to specific industry requirements. The market for these converters is driven by the growing demand for robust, long-lasting power solutions in harsh industrial settings, as well as the need for compliance with stringent safety and performance standards.

The global Through-Hole Mount Isolated DC Converters market size was estimated at USD 211.03 million in 2024, exhibiting a CAGR of 5.25% during the forecast period.
